Role

Responsible for procuring pulpwood for the Delmar, Maryland facility via stumpage acquisition and open-market purchases to meet budgeted fiber requirements.  Incumbent may also manage local or regional residual chip accounts that are delivered direct to the Spring Grove, Pennsylvania papermill.

 Accountabilities

·         The incumbent will purchase standing timber and open-market wood.

·         Responsible for accurately cruising and valuating both private-negotiated and bid timber.

·         Proficiency in contacting landowners and generating prospective timber leads.

·         Responsible for timber sale layout, administration, retirement, and closing work.

·         Responsible for developing new and maintaining existing working relationships with logging and transportation contractors.

·         As directed by the Forest Operations Manager, develop and maintain working relationships with area sawmills to ensure viable markets for controlled sawtimber and facilitating the procurement of residual chips.

·         Promote the Company Forest Certification program (SFI & FSC), as well as environmental compliance through adherence of BMP standards and Forest Certification principles.

·         Provide technical assistance to select suppliers and producers, promoting continuous improvement and high levels of performance that are sustainable and consistent.

·         Active participation in Company safety program.

·         Serve as the liaison with state and local agencies and trade associations as well as promoting a positive public image through civic involvement.

·         Assist Delmar Woodyard Manager with administrative, managerial, and/or operational items on occasion.
